Abstract

To provide an image processing device that calculates a parameter used for correcting large video jitter with high accuracy even when the accuracy of a sensor for measuring a movement of a photographing device is low. The image processing device includes: a constraint condition generating unit () that generates a constraint condition using sensor information such that a parameter value falls within a range; and a parameter calculating unit () that calculates the parameter according to the constraint condition. The constraint condition generating unit () has: a feature vector generating unit () that generates a feature vector showing features of the sensor information; and a motion classifying unit (such as) that identifies a movement of the photographing device according to the feature vector generated by the feature vector generating unit (), on the basis of an association between the feature vector and the movement of the photographing device, the association being obtained as a result of previously-executed machine learning of the feature vector and an actual movement of the photographing device. The constraint condition generating unit () determines the range corresponding to the information of the movement of the photographing device, the movement being identified by the motion classifying unit (such as).
